📜 Historical events on this date

768
Charlemagne and his brother Carloman I are crowned Kings of The Franks.

1000
Leif Ericson discovers "Vinland" (possibly L'Anse aux Meadows, Canada) reputedly becoming first European to reach North America.

1446
The Hangul alphabet is published in Korea.

1831
Ioannis Kapodistrias, first Head of State of modern Greece, assassinated in Nafplion.

1941
US President Franklin D. Roosevelt approves an atomic program - beginning of the Manhattan project.

2006
North Korea conducts its first nuclear test, with an estimated yield of between 0.4-2 kilotons.
